QA Engineer (тестувальник) — це спеціаліст, який перевіряє програмне забезпечення, щоб знайти помилки та переконатися, що продукт працює правильно. Якщо пояснити простими словами, QA — це людина, яка “ламає” сайт або додаток, щоб користувачі отримали якісний і стабільний продукт.
Це одна з найпопулярніших професій в IT для початківців, оскільки не потребує глибоких знань програмування на старті.
Хто такий QA Engineer простими словами
QA Engineer — це тестувальник, який:
👉 перевіряє сайт або додаток
👉 шукає помилки (баги)
👉 описує проблеми для розробників
👉 контролює якість продукту
📌 Простий приклад:
Ти відкриваєш сайт, натискаєш кнопку — і нічого не відбувається.
QA — це той, хто знаходить цю проблему ДО користувача.
Що робить QA Engineer (основні задачі)
1. Перевірка функціоналу
QA тестує, чи все працює так, як задумано:
- кнопки
- форми
- переходи між сторінками
2. Пошук багів
QA спеціально шукає помилки:
- щось не відкривається
- текст з’їхав
- дані не зберігаються
3. Написання баг-репортів
QA описує проблему для розробника:
- що сталося
- як повторити
- який очікуваний результат
4. Повторне тестування (ретест)
Після виправлення QA перевіряє:
👉 чи дійсно проблема зникла
5. Комунікація з командою
QA працює разом з:
- розробниками
- дизайнерами
- менеджерами
Які бувають QA Engineer
🧪 Manual QA
Перевіряє все вручну без коду
👉 найкращий варіант для старту
🤖 Automation QA
Пише автоматичні тести (потрібно знати програмування)
Які навички потрібні QA Engineer
Навіть без досвіду важливо:
✔ уважність до деталей
✔ логічне мислення
✔ терпіння
✔ базове розуміння роботи сайтів
✔ англійська (мінімум A2-B1)
QA Engineer — це спеціаліст, який відповідає за якість продукту. Він допомагає знайти помилки ще до того, як їх побачать користувачі. Це чудова професія для старту в IT без досвіду та програмування.
